环境说明
操作系统:Ubuntu 22.04 LTS
相关命令
wget https://gmplib.org/download/gmp/gmp-6.2.1.tar.xz # 从官网下载安装包,这里使用6.2.1版本
xz -d gmp-6.2.1.tar.xz # 第一步解压
tar -xvf gmp-6.2.1.tar # 第二步解压
cd gmp-6.2.1 # 进入根目录
./configure CFLAGS=”-march=native -O3” CXXFLAGS=”-march=native -O3” # 加载配置(后面的参数是把它作为共享库shared library安装)
make # 编译
make check # 检验
sudo make install # 安装
cd .. # 回到根目录下
sudo apt install libgmp-dev # 安装环境依赖
检查是否安装成功
执行上述安装步骤后,在/usr/local/lib文件夹下生成几个文件:libgmp.a, libgmp.la, libgmp.so. 在/usr/local/include文件夹下生成gmp.h.